Bajaj Pulsar N125 vs TVS Fiero 125

Choosing between the Bajaj Pulsar N125 vs TVS Fiero 125? BikeJunction is here to help! The Pulsar N125 starts at ₹ 91,692, while the Fiero 125 is priced at ₹ 69,141 (ex-showroom). You can easily compare all the required parameters for your new two-wheeler. These two-wheelers have powerful motors with good performance. Among them, the Pulsar N125 offers 11 Nm @ 6000 rpm torque. The Fiero 125 gives 11.2 Nm @ 6,000 rpm torque.
